Teaching

Northeastern University

I was teaching assistant for NETS6116: Network Science 2 taught by Dmitri Krioukov in Spring 2023. I was also created syllabi for the directed study courses NETS7976: Reasoning under Uncertainty with Probabilistic Machine Learning and NETS7976: Information Theory & Bayesian Inference for Complex Systems with Brennan Klein in Fall 2022 and Fall 2023 respectively. As part of courses at the Center for Advancing Teaching and Learning through Research (CATLR), at Northeastern University I have designed formal and non-formal learning experiences including a a first course in network science.

Karlruhse Institute of Technology (KIT)

I was teaching assistant for the lectures Advanced Mathematics for Physics I and Advanced Mathematics for Physics II taught by Christoph Schmöger and Ioannis Anapolitanos in Summer 2016, 2019, 2020 and Winter 2017, 2018, 2019, 2020. The MINT-Kolleg at KIT offers preparatory course for incoming Bachelor students on various topics. I was a tutor for physics in Fall 2016 and tutor for in mathematics and physics in Fall 2017.

Karlsruhe University of Applied Sciences (HSK)

Karlsruhe University of Applied Sciences offers preparatory courses for various subjects for incoming Bachelor students from different engineering discplines. I was tutor for the course in physics in Fall 2019 and 2020 and for mathematics in 2018.